The icebug Pytho2 has series of slightly retractable spikes, these spikes enable you run over hard packed snow and ice without having to slow down or change your gait.

I have worn these shoes for over 150 miles now throughout the winter of 2012-2013. We have had a lot snow, frozen rain and freeze thaw cycles making for slippery conditions underfoot. Wearing the Icebugs I have been able to plow through these adverse conditions without fear of falling. The Pytho is a low drop shoe with a rather stiff midsole, its best suited for trails and shorter ice infested urban runs. I have ran up to 10 miles on the streets in them, they are easier to run in then YakTrax but running on the treated streets is not my favorite activity in these shoes. I have ran up 20 miles on hard snow packed and ice covered trails, thats were these shoes really shine. Tonight I ran in near blizzard conditions on the Lake front trail, I did not have to worry about ice and water resistant upper works well when you get caught in a snow drift.

The shoes look to be very durable, I am sure they will last many seasons, making the seemingly high price point become a relative bargain. The midsole is a little hard and inflexible, thats why I rating them 4/5. The fit a little large, but in the winter I like to wear slightly thicker smart wool socks, I got mine true to size and they fit fine.

Did 15 miles in my new Icebug Pytho2 BUGrip trail shoes. Started on the asphalt trail, which had been plowed, for the first 3 miles. The next 4 miles had 4" to 6" of snow. A littler respite over the last 1/2 miles to the turnaround point. On the way back we met a tractor plowing the trail, so the return trip was on asphalt with patches of snow 1/2" to 1" deep. A little bit of ice under the snow but nothing dangerous. The shoes fit me well and nothing chafed or rubbed. They are water resistant so my feet stayed fairly dry. The carbide spikes built into the soles provided great traction and security. I was confident running down the steepest hill on the route despite it being unplowed. I tried a different Icebug model on the previous Tuesday doing hill repeats on a an asphalt trail with 1/2" to 1" of slick snow and had good traction at all times. For winter conditions, these are great trail shoes. I think they'd also be good on muddy and soft trails.
